The Ripple Effect takes a very simple idea and manages to spin it out into an amusing and entertaining read. The basic concept is to take one simple action, in this case the absence due to worker error of the jam filling in a jam donut, and tells the story of how the impact of this has on a number of supposedly unconnected lives, changing both careers, fortunes and the health of a number of diverse characters.

...Cooper (real name Robert Popper, the man behind some of Look Around you with Simon Pegg and scripter of Series 3 of Peep Show with Radio 4's Mitchell and Webb) is a man of considerable spare time.
To help pass the hours he writes letters to member organizations, rotary clubs, airlines and other venerable organs with bizzarre, nonsensical requests, or just to waste their time with crazed inventions he has made and wishes to share with a rightly disinterested ... ...[End of Correspondence] stamp when the organization simply no longer responds to his absurd and increasingly mental missives. Some of the most outstanding letters include a noise reducing machine known as the Imsimil Berati-Lahn (this made me cackle for a good hour), a machine that harvests mustard from wasps (Waspard!) and an offer to supply Beef Scarecrows (later corrected to 'Beel'!) to a Gardening Centre. Originally working for the gas board, Eric quit his job and took to writing.
His first play was 'The Banana Box'. This was a moderate success and coincidentally starred Leonard Rossiter, Frances de la Tour and Don Warrington.
Points of interest, in the banana box the landlord was actually called Rooksby. Philip was already a tenant with his own flat.
